Trader consensus on Polymarket positions Australia’s Delta Goodrem with "Eclipse" as the slim jury frontrunner at 29.5% implied probability for Eurovision 2026's jury winner, closely trailed by France’s Monroe ("Regarde!" at 23.5%) and Denmark’s Søren Torpegaard Lund ("Før vi går hjem" at 22.5%), reflecting sophisticated ballads and strong vocal deliveries favored by professional juries. Recent Eurojury mock votes from the past week—Australia gaining points from Moldova, Sweden, and Denmark—have tightened the race, with Denmark and Finland briefly tying atop tallies before bookmakers adjusted for Delta’s experienced campaign and emotional staging potential. Finland lags at 13.5% amid stronger televote buzz, underscoring jury-public splits. First rehearsals in Vienna next week could catalyze shifts via production polish and live previews ahead of the May 16 final.

This market will resolve to the country that receives the highest number of points from the professional juries in the Grand Final of the Eurovision Song Contest 2026.
All ties will be broken according to EBU's official Eurovision rules.
If no winner is announced by July 31, 2026, 11:59 PM ET, this market will resolve to "No".
The primary resolution source for this market will be official information from Eurovision (https://eurovision.tv/), including live footage of Eurovision 2026, however a consensus of credible reporting will suffice.
